Cleveland Guardians vs Houston Astros Picks and Predictions for Saturday, June 20, 2026
Guardians vs Astros Game Information
The Cleveland Guardians stay on the road Saturday night for a 7:15 PM matchup at Dalkin Park in Houston, TX, against the Houston Astros. Cleveland has 40 wins and 36 losses this season, coming into Saturday with 3 losses in the last 5 after a 6-run loss in Game 1 of this series. The Houston Astros stay home Saturday, 5 games below .500, but ride a 3-game winning streak into this matchup. For other MLB news, see our MLB Picks.
Guardians Preview
The Cleveland offense has a .229 batting average this season, scoring 298 runs on 562 hits. Cleveland has a .315 OBP and a .370 team slugging percentage. Cleveland's pitching has been the team's biggest strength this year, with a 3.79 team ERA, but they have allowed 20 runs over their last 3 losses. Brayan Rocchio leads the Cleveland offense this season with a .273 batting average. Angel Martinez has a .239 batting average and leads the team with 11 home runs. Chase DeLauter has a .263 batting average and leads Cleveland with 34 RBI's.
Astros Preview
The Houston Astros offense has compiled a .243 batting average and has scored 344 runs on 621 hits this season. Houston has a .318 OBP and a .412 team slugging percentage. Houston's pitching has been the team's biggest issue this year, with a 4.87 ERA, but they have allowed just 7 runs across their current 3-game winning streak. Yordan Alvarez does it all for the Houston offense, leading the team with a .324 batting average, 24 home runs, and 55 RBI's.
Guardians vs Astros Pitching Matchup
Joey Cantillo will be on the mound for Cleveland on Saturday, looking to end their recent woes. Cantillo is 5-3 this year with a 4.38 ERA over 72 innings. Spencer Arrighetti will counter for Houston. This season, Arrighetti is 7-2 overall with a 2.57 ERA over 63 innings.
